“It
is important to have an open door policy. If we want
to be successful, we can’t be afraid to ask questions. My
door is always open.” said
Gayle Vannicola, business manager.
Although Vannicola has worked in various
departments at the university since 1978, the J-School
has quickly become home for her.
“There
is a unique bond between students, faculty and everyone
who walks the halls of Stauffer-Flint which is essential
for professional and personal success,” said
Gayle Vannicola, business manager.
Vannicola manages
the school’s various accounts
and provides Dean Brill with the financial standings
of the J-School. She enjoys her role within the
School because compiling reports, working hard and
accurately and “having everything balance in
the end” is what gives (her) the greatest satisfaction.
